Before you even think about other road users, the road gives you information: how it turns, how much grip it offers, what lies along its edges. Three glances are enough.
Three glances at the road
Course, surface, verges – three criteria you can read in seconds.

The course: where does the road go and how far can I see? A blind bend, a crest or a dip limits your field of vision – and therefore your sensible maximum speed.
The surface: dry, wet, patched, gravelled? Changes in colour and texture announce changes in grip.
The verges: hedges, walls, parked vehicles, driveways, pavements. This is where the unseen emerges from.
